| Aspect | Customer Experience Leader | Customer Service Manager |
|---|
| Primary Focus | Overall customer journey and strategic experience improvements | Managing customer service teams and daily support operations |
| Skills & Certifications | Customer experience strategies, leadership, analytics | Customer service skills, team management, conflict resolution |
| Work Environment | Cross-departmental collaboration, strategic planning | Customer support centers, call centers, support teams |
| Industry Usage | Retail, tech, hospitality, and service sectors | Retail, telecom, banking, and service industries |
The Customer Experience Leader focuses on shaping the overall customer journey and strategic improvements, often working across departments. In contrast, the Customer Service Manager handles daily customer support operations and team management. Both roles require strong communication skills, but the Experience Leader emphasizes strategic planning and analytics, while the Service Manager concentrates on team performance and issue resolution.
